Firefish

Recruitment CRM with built-in marketing for UK agencies

4.4
£80/user/moReported

Best for: UK agencies that treat their website and brand as a candidate channel

Recruitment marketing (website CMS, campaigns, engagement tracking) built in

Outstanding UK-based support reputation

Rigid contract lengths reported by customers

Some job board integrations are paid extras

Zoho Recruit

Recruitment module of the Zoho suite

4.4
$30/user/moReported

Best for: Teams already in the Zoho ecosystem, or on a tight budget

Very affordable with a real free tier

Immense custom-field flexibility

Clunky, dated interface

Overwhelming learning curve for non-technical users

What does Firefish cost?

Firefish pricing starts at £80/user/mo (reported, reviewed July 4, 2026). Vendor site is quote-led; Capterra reports Basic £80, Professional £90, Enterprise £105 per user/mo (Capterra, Oct 2025). Contract terms not verified; some job board integrations cost extra.

What does Zoho Recruit cost?

Zoho Recruit pricing starts at $30/user/mo (reported, reviewed July 4, 2026). Standard $30/user/mo and Enterprise $60/user/mo (billed annually) per research capture, but note the corporate/internal-HR edition's current page is quote-led with plans tied to active-job limits, so exact figures are pending re-verification. Free tier and 15-day trial confirmed (Jul 2026).
